
Hanging Chain Aerator
Product Introduction
The suspended chain aeration system consists of three parts: the aerator, the suspended chain, and the water surface air supply tube. The aeration film tube is made of三元乙丙 or silicone rubber material, the suspended chain connecting tube is a high-strength polyethylene pipe, and the floating tube on the water surface is an anti-ultraviolet rigid-wall flexible plastic tube.

Technical Specifications

【Applicable Range】
The suspended chain aeration device is a new energy-saving aeration equipment for biochemical treatment projects of industrial wastewater in petrochemical, textile, oil refining, coking, papermaking, dyeing, slaughtering, brewing, leather making, and other industries, as well as urban domestic wastewater.
2. In cases where the efficiency of existing aeration systems is low or clogging occurs frequently, a suspended chain aeration system can be used for retrofitting to enhance aeration capacity and mixing effects.
3. Pre-aeration for wastewater equalization ponds to prevent large particle sedimentation and to remove some organic matter.
Installation and Commissioning
1. Suspended chain aeration devices are generally evenly arranged at the bottom of the water treatment pool, with the aeration devices 100-200mm from the pool bottom and the longitudinal distanceGenerally300—500mm。
2. Install gas delivery hoses and clamps, floating gas pipes and caps, suspended joint and clamp, suspended pipeline and clamp, and aeration devices.
【Installation Method】
At the bottom of the pool, sequentially number and arrange the gas transmission float pipes and caps. Weld them into a single pipe using a plastic welder. Ensure the suspended joints are aligned in a single parallel line and cut the chains to the design size. Connect one end of the chain to the aeration device and the other end to the float pipe with a clamp. Connect the gas transmission hose to the float pipe, tighten the clamp, attach the wire rope to the float pipe, tighten the gas transmission hose mouth to prevent leakage, and tie the wire rope with a soft rope to the embedded fixture at the pool edge. Begin filling the pool; once full, first turn on the fan to blow out the pipeline. Connect the gas transmission hose to the manifold. Adjust the length of the wire rope, start the blower, adjust the intake valve to ensure even aeration for each chain, and check for any leaks at all connection points.
